CUSTER v. BALDWIN

(CV94-0821; CA A95346)

986 P.2d 1203 (1999)

163 Or. App. 60

Jimmie L. CUSTER, Appellant, v. G.H. BALDWIN, Superintendent, Eastern Oregon Correctional Institution, Respondent.

Court of Appeals of Oregon.

Decided September 22, 1999.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

J.R. Perkins, III argued the cause and filed the brief for appellant.

Jonathan H. Fussner, Assistant Attorney General, argued the cause for respondent. With him on the brief were Hardy Myers, Attorney General, and Michael D. Reynolds, Solicitor General.

Before De MUNIZ, Presiding Judge, and HASELTON and WOLLHEIM, Judges.


HASELTON, J.

Petitioner appeals from a judgment dismissing his action for post-conviction relief, which arose from his conviction for sodomy in the first degree. ORS 163.405.
